Les échelles de fatigue utilisées au cours de … WebThe MFIS is a modified form of the Fatigue Impact Scale (FIS). It is one of the components of the Multiple Sclerosis Quality of Life Inventory (MSQLI). The original MFIS contains 21 items. An abbreviated 5-item version is also available.
